Realtime comments made easy with Pusher and GatsbyThis tutorial was written by Chris Nwamba and originally appeared on the Pusher Blog.According to Wikipedia, a static web page (sometimes called a flat page/stationary page) is a web page that is delivered to the user exactly as stored, in contrast to dynamic web pages which are generated by a web applicationGatsby is a modern static site generator that allows you to build static web pages using React and GraphQl. Getting started with Gatsby is pretty easy and its installation is an npm install or yarn install away.Today we'll be adding a realtime comment section to the sports blog we'll be building. We'll call our blog the "Football transfer buzz with Gordon Mc-gossip".
